Sony Pictures will release the Salt Sequel

Salt is starring in the movie by Angelina Jolie, Liev Schreiber, Chiwetel Ejiofor, and Daniel Olbrychski. successful profit 300 million U.S. dollars in the whole world eventually tempt the Sony Pictures to develop a sequel salt project. According to Deadline, Kurt Wimmer who became a screenwriter in the first movie sequel is currently writing a story.

Salt was released in 2010 about a CIA agent named Evelyn Salt (Angelina Jolie) that loyalty is tested when a defector accused of spying for Russia. Salt who must flee from the pursuit of his friends must uncover the actual case and using his skills to escape from the pursuit of the CIA.

Cheryl Cole Dropped From 'The X Factor' Over Her Thick Accent; Will Be Replaced By Nicole Scherzinger

British pop star Cheryl Cole has been dropped as a judge on the U.S. version of Simon Cowell's The X Factor and replaced by Nicole Scherzinger, according to a new report. Cole was due to appear on the Stateside launch of the show with fellow judges L.A. Reid, Paula Abdul and Cowell, but TMZ.com now claims the British beauty is no longer part of the talent show line-up.
The website reports that producers feared Cole's English accent would be too difficult for American audiences to understand. It is believed former Pussycat Doll Scherzinger, who was set to co-host the program, will now step in to fill the void. Welsh TV personality Steve Jones is still expected to present the show, which will debut in America later this year.
